Abstract :

Hip fractures, one of the most common geriatric injuries, the incidence continues to rise in Latin America with an aging population, and is associated with adverse patient outcomes and significant costs. Many factors have a negative impact can be modifiable, like pre and post management, time of surgery, type of fixation. As patients age, the comorbidities increase, complicating the outcomes. The quality and consistency in the management of patients with hip fractures varies substantially from one country to another, and there is no standarization of the patway of treatment. One of the diffculties is the economical factor. To reduce the negative impacts and burden of disease, we are working to establish, and develop standarized pathway to treat this important disease in Latin America and globally.
